Overview

Annually, the customer contact industry comes together for a significant event that serves as a platform for professionals and stakeholders to unite and engage in meaningful discussions about the various successes and challenges that permeate the industry. This gathering typically features a diverse array of participants, including customer service representatives, managers, executives, and technology providers, all of whom bring unique perspectives and insights to the table.


During this event, attendees have the opportunity to share their experiences, celebrate innovations that have positively impacted customer interactions, and address the obstacles that continue to hinder progress in the field. Workshops, panel discussions, and networking sessions are often included in the agenda, allowing for in-depth exploration of topics such as emerging technologies, evolving customer expectations, and best practices for enhancing customer satisfaction.


By fostering collaboration and knowledge sharing, this annual assembly plays a crucial role in driving the industry forward, equipping participants with the tools and strategies necessary to navigate the ever-changing landscape of customer contact.
